    I don't want to sound like a cane-shaking old man but I rather enjoy talking on the phone. Two separate times in the past two months I got a text from a different friend who I haven't seen in 1-3 years. Each time, we had like 3 back-and-forth messages before I determined "this is important enough that we deserve to actually hear each other" and called her instead, and the call was always well recieved, and they both actually sounded happy. And beyond that, I hate having to end texts in "lol", a phrase which clearly does not mean "laughing out loud", but rather means "this short message carries no hostile intent"; something you don't need to clarify when speaking on the phone. Plus, it's good practice for learning to be a smooth-talker, when you only need to worry about your speech and not about your posture or dress. And smooth-talking is useful.

    Now, what I do hate is leaving voicemails. That is awkward 100% of the time. If it's not a call I'm making for work, then I absolutely will just text instead. Talking to a wall for 30 seconds hoping to have all my ducks in a row? No thanks.
